West Winds wins Ultimate Spirits Challenge Trophy

by Stefanie Collins

West Winds gin, The Cutlass, has been named has taken out the Chairman’s Trophy for best gin at the New York Ultimate Spirits Challenge.

With a score of 97 out of 100 The Cutlass beat other more established and well-known gin houses including Bombay Sapphire, Hendrick’s and Beefeater to take home the Champion’s Trophy.

In their tasting notes for the gin the judges said: “Sea breeze and airy mountain herbs dominate the nose with an underlying note of bergamot and pine. Robust, earthy and herb-forward on the palate with a deep minerality and a hunt of luscious lemon. Finishes bold and dry.”

The Ultimate Spirits Challenge isn’t just a standard one-off event, it incorporates a designated year-round facility and a tasting team of industry experts including Don Lee, Jeff Bell, Joaquin Simo and Dave Wondrich.
